0


Python|(解决)苹果mac电脑无法打开“chromedriver”,因为无法验证开发者,要怎么解决?

前言

我们工作上,很多朋友都是使用的Windows系统电脑,但还是有部分朋友使用的是苹果mac电脑,Windows系统电脑这里不细说,今天好好说下使用苹果mac电脑遇到关于使用selenium的问题。废话不多说,跟着小编直接进入正题。

解决****苹果mac电脑无法打开‘chromedriver’,因为无法验证开发者

当使用苹果电脑安装好chromedriver驱动之后,使用selenium打开谷歌浏览器,会遇到下面的问题,图片如下:

解决办法:

首先需要找到安装chromedriver驱动的绝对路径

比如说,我这里的路径是:/Users/edy/Desktop/rich/webdriver/chromedriver

那现在需要做的就是绕开苹果的允许,需要切换到chromedriver目录下执行

第一步,直接打开pycharm的终端,输入如下命令,并按回车键

cd /Users/edy/Desktop/rich/webdriver

第二步,在终端继续输入如下命令,并按回车键

xattr -d com.apple.quarantine chromedriver

接下来,我们在pycharm中执行下面的代码:

from selenium import webdriver

path = r'/Users/edy/Desktop/rich/webdriver/chromedriver'
url = 'https://www.baidu.com'

driver = webdriver.Chrome(path)
driver.get(url)

运行成功之后,你会发现,你的苹果mac电脑就可以正常使用selenium打开谷歌浏览器了。

如果喜欢本文或者本文对你有帮助的话,记得关注小编并点个赞哟,有问题和需求欢迎留言私信。

Python|如何正确安装PaddleOCR

标签: macos selenium python

本文转载自: https://blog.csdn.net/Leexin_love_Ling/article/details/125443374
版权归原作者 写python的鑫哥 所有, 如有侵权,请联系我们删除。

“Python|(解决)苹果mac电脑无法打开“chromedriver”,因为无法验证开发者,要怎么解决?”的评论:

还没有评论